#843b44 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#843b44 is composed of 51.8% red, 23.1%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.3% magenta, 48.5%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 352.6 degrees, a saturation of 38.2% and a lightness of 37.5%. #843b44 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7688 with #090000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

● #843b44 color description : Dark moderate red.
#843b44 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#843b44 has RGB values of R:132, G:59,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.48,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 8665924.

Shades and Tints of #843b44
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0405 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fc is the lightest one.
